Company Description

BEUMER Group is an international manufacturing leader in intralogistics in the fields of conveying, loading, palletising, packaging, sortation and distribution technology. BEUMER Group offers the right solution for almost every logistic challenge. We are a family owned, intralogistics leader, where tradition and innovation go hand in hand. Job Description

BEUMER Corporation is expanding its value services for our Conveying & Loading Customers in North America by providing for additional capacity for the installation, commissioning, maintenance and support of all the BEUMER conveying systems and equipment in a customer’s facility.  Our main goals and objectives are safety and to maximize uptime at best possible value.

These systems include BEUMER Overland Conveyor Systems, AFR, and traditional Heavy duty Conveying equipment. BEUMER Corporation is looking for an experienced Field Service Technician in order to support these technologies.  

General Responsibility

The Field Service Technician is a hands-on leadership role requiring strong mechanical and electrical expertise, along with experience in heavy conveying systems and maintenance operations. The ideal candidate brings solid technical knowledge, a deep understanding of system technology, and the interpersonal skills needed to communicate effectively and support team success. With the team, you will utilize on site and hands on training and partnering to expand your technical skills as you support critical materials handling systems and their operations. The focus will be on gaining expertise on the latest technology being presently implemented in these facilities.  

Must be able and willing to travel up to 80% of the time.

Primary Responsibilities

The Field Service Technician performs and manages the installation, commissioning, service and support of the critical BEUMER system. Your primary objective is to provide supervision and excellence for the installation and support of these systems.

The Field Service Technician has advanced technical capabilities and experience, can perform and train on all of the duties required for the maintenance, troubleshooting, monitoring and reporting of these systems. The Field Service Technician is responsible for the following:

  • Understanding customer requirements and how they translate into operational and functional requirements of the systems.
  • Access and troubleshooting of electro-mechanical components, including IO cabling and network components.
  • Effective communication with Customers and Internal technical resources to aid resolution
  • Provide accurate and timely written reports of operational and maintenance issues.
  • Interpret data and suggest maintenance schedule/activity adjustments Operate systems and components to demonstrate equipment and to analyze malfunctions
  • Inspects, determine, oversee and perform corrective, emergency and preventative maintenance of the conveying systems and its associated components
  • Analyze and review findings to determine source of problem, and recommends repair, replacement, or other corrective action as well as coordinate problem resolution with engineering, customer service, and other personnel to expedite repairs.
  • Interprets maintenance manuals, schematics, and wiring diagrams, and repairs equipment, utilizing knowledge of electronics and using standard test instruments and hand tools.
  • Consults with engineering personnel to resolve unusual problems in system operation and maintenance.
  • Supervise workers in installation, testing, tuning, and adjusting equipment to obtain optimum operating performance.
  • Prepare detailed Service reports and or as-built documentation for work completed.
  • May be assigned to special projects or required to perform other duties not listed above, which may vary from time to time as determined by management, to meet company needs.
